From: Byungchul Park <byungchul.park@lge.com> To: torvalds@linux-foundation.org Cc: damien.lemoal@opensource.wdc.com, linux-ide@vger.kernel.org, adilger.kernel@dilger.ca, linux-ext4@vger.kernel.org, mingo@redhat.com, lin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org, peterz@infradead.org, will@kernel.org, tglx@linutronix.de, rostedt@goodmis.org, joel@joelfernandes.org, sashal@kernel.org, daniel.vetter@ffwll.ch, chris@chris-wilson.co.uk, duyuyang@gmail.com, johannes.berg@intel.com, tj@kernel.org, tytso@mit.edu, willy@infradead.org, david@fromorbit.com, amir73il@gmail.com, bfields@fieldses.org, gregkh@linuxfoundation.org, kernel-team@lge.com, linux-mm@kvack.org, akpm@linux-foundation.org, mhocko@kernel.org, minchan@kernel.org, hannes@cmpxchg.org, vdavydov.dev@gmail.com, sj@kernel.org, jglisse@redhat.com, dennis@kernel.org, cl@linux.com, penberg@kernel.org, rientjes@google.com, vbabka@suse.cz, ngupta@vflare.org, linux-block@vger.kernel.org, paolo.valente@linaro.org, josef@toxicpanda.com, linux-fsdevel@vger.kernel.org, viro@zeniv.linux.org.uk, jack@suse.cz, jack@suse.com, jlayton@kernel.org, dan.j.williams@intel.com, hch@infradead.org, djwong@kernel.org, dri-devel@lists.freedesktop.org, airlied@linux.ie, rodrigosiqueiramelo@gmail.com, melissa.srw@gmail.com, hamohammed.sa@gmail.com, 42.hyeyoo@gmail.com Subject: [PATCH RFC v6 03/21] dept: Apply Dept to spinlock Date: Wed, 4 May 2022 17:17:31 +0900 [thread overview] Message-ID: <1651652269-15342-4-git-send-email-byungchul.park@lge.com> (raw) In-Reply-To: <1651652269-15342-1-git-send-email-byungchul.park@lge.com> Makes Dept able to track dependencies by spinlock. Signed-off-by: Byungchul Park <byungchul.park@lge.com> --- include/linux/lockdep.h | 18 +++++++++++++++--- include/linux/spinlock.h | 21 +++++++++++++++++++++ include/linux/spinlock_types_raw.h | 3 +++ 3 files changed, 39 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-) diff --git a/include/linux/lockdep.h b/include/linux/lockdep.h index aee4660..4fa91d5 100644 --- a/include/linux/lockdep.h +++ b/include/linux/lockdep.h @@ -572,9 +572,21 @@ static inline void print_irqtrace_events(struct task_struct *curr) #define lock_acquire_shared(l, s, t, n, i) lock_acquire(l, s, t, 1, 1, n, i) #define lock_acquire_shared_recursive(l, s, t, n, i) lock_acquire(l, s, t, 2, 1, n, i) -#define spin_acquire(l, s, t, i) lock_acquire_exclusive(l, s, t, NULL, i) -#define spin_acquire_nest(l, s, t, n, i) lock_acquire_exclusive(l, s, t, n, i) -#define spin_release(l, i) lock_release(l, i) +#define spin_acquire(l, s, t, i) \ +do { \ + lock_acquire_exclusive(l, s, t, NULL, i); \ + dept_spin_lock(&(l)->dmap, s, t, NULL, "spin_unlock", i); \ +} while (0) +#define spin_acquire_nest(l, s, t, n, i) \ +do { \ + lock_acquire_exclusive(l, s, t, n, i); \ + dept_spin_lock(&(l)->dmap, s, t, (n) ? &(n)->dmap : NULL, "spin_unlock", i); \ +} while (0) +#define spin_release(l, i) \ +do { \ + lock_release(l, i); \ + dept_spin_unlock(&(l)->dmap, i); \ +} while (0) #define rwlock_acquire(l, s, t, i) lock_acquire_exclusive(l, s, t, NULL, i) #define rwlock_acquire_read(l, s, t, i) \ diff --git a/include/linux/spinlock.h b/include/linux/spinlock.h index 5c0c517..191fb99 100644 --- a/include/linux/spinlock.h +++ b/include/linux/spinlock.h @@ -95,6 +95,27 @@ # include <linux/spinlock_up.h> #endif +#ifdef CONFIG_DEPT +#define dept_spin_lock(m, ne, t, n, e_fn, ip) \ +do { \ + if (t) { \ + dept_ecxt_enter(m, 1UL, ip, __func__, e_fn, ne); \ + } else if (n) { \ + dept_ecxt_enter_nokeep(m); \ + } else { \ + dept_wait(m, 1UL, ip, __func__, ne); \ + dept_ecxt_enter(m, 1UL, ip, __func__, e_fn, ne); \ + } \ +} while (0) +#define dept_spin_unlock(m, ip) \ +do { \ + dept_ecxt_exit(m, 1UL, ip); \ +} while (0) +#else +#define dept_spin_lock(m, ne, t, n, e_fn, ip) do { } while (0) +#define dept_spin_unlock(m, ip) do { } while (0) +#endif + #ifdef CONFIG_DEBUG_SPINLOCK extern void __raw_spin_lock_init(raw_spinlock_t *lock, const char *name, struct lock_class_key *key, short inner); diff --git a/include/linux/spinlock_types_raw.h b/include/linux/spinlock_types_raw.h index 91cb36b..1a1da54 100644 --- a/include/linux/spinlock_types_raw.h +++ b/include/linux/spinlock_types_raw.h @@ -31,11 +31,13 @@ .dep_map = { \ .name = #lockname, \ .wait_type_inner = LD_WAIT_SPIN, \ + .dmap = DEPT_MAP_INITIALIZER(lockname) \ } # define SPIN_DEP_MAP_INIT(lockname) \ .dep_map = { \ .name = #lockname, \ .wait_type_inner = LD_WAIT_CONFIG, \ + .dmap = DEPT_MAP_INITIALIZER(lockname) \ } # define LOCAL_SPIN_DEP_MAP_INIT(lockname) \ @@ -43,6 +45,7 @@ .name = #lockname, \ .wait_type_inner = LD_WAIT_CONFIG, \ .lock_type = LD_LOCK_PERCPU, \ + .dmap = DEPT_MAP_INITIALIZER(lockname) \ } #else # define RAW_SPIN_DEP_MAP_INIT(lockname) -- 1.9.1
